FAKE ROYAL MAIL EMAIL DUMPS VIRUS ON CARLISLE WOMAN'S COMPUTER http://www.newsandstar.co.uk/news/fake- ... up_1_50001" onclick="window.open(this.href);return false;
Internet users are being warned to be vigilant after a Carlisle woman's computer contracted a virus when opening an email supposedly from Royal Mail.
Sharon Atkinson, from Currock, found the email in the ‘junk’ folder of her account.
It said that a package for her had been wrongly addressed and that she had to follow a link to find out more information. When she did so, the virus affected her machine.
A spokesperson for Royal Mail has advised caution for anyone who receives such an e-mail: “Royal Mail does not send unsolicited emails to customers regarding items of mail which we have been unable to deliver.
“If the postman or woman is unable to deliver a parcel to a customer they will leave a card which explains how to arrange a redelivery or where to collect the item.”
